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ES
As the Radiology Technologist Senior, you will perform and assist in a variety of standard and specialized radiographic examinations and procedures. Demonstrates competency in all age groups and works in accordance with established policies and procedures.

- Works independently using extensive knowledge of anatomy, physiology, positioning, radiation physics and radiation dosage
- Confirms appropriate clinical data, obtains patient history and uses the lowest possible dose to provide high quality images for the interpreting radiologist
- Delivers excellent customer service and support to patients and clinicians, answering phones, scheduling, and conducting outreach calls on behalf of the radiology department
- Provides for the emotional, physical wellbeing and safety of the patient while maintaining strict standards of patient confidentiality
- Possesses the ability to communicate effectively with patients as well as other members of the health care team
- Understands and is competent in other Radiology Department job responsibilities and performs these functions on a regular basis
- Recognizes and effectively communicates equipment problems in a timely manner to the Department Supervisor

BASIC QUALIFICATIONS
- High School diploma or equivalency certificate (e.g. GED, HiSET, TASC Test) from an accredited institution or governmental unit
- Graduate of an accredited radiography program
- ARRT License or registry eligible
- Licensed in Massachusetts as a radiologic technologist
- Ability to provide CEU documentation required for licensure

What Massachusetts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in radiology technologist jobs across Massachusetts.
- ARRT certification in Radiography or a relevant modality required
- Active state licensure or eligibility to obtain state license
- Associate degree or bachelor's degree in Radiologic Technology
- Proficiency operating CT, MRI, or fluoroscopy equipment
- BLS or ACLS certification required prior to start date
- One to two years of clinical or hospital imaging experience preferred

How much do radiology technologists make in Massachusetts?
Radiology technologists in Massachusetts earn a median of about $103,620 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$75,350 for the lowest 10% to over $131,940 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.
